Bradenton Overview

Life in the sunshine state doesn't get much better than Bradenton, Florida. Ideally located in the aptly-named Manatee County, this on-the-move southern hot spot is a fantastic place to live, work and play. 

Why live in Bradenton, FL?

Home to numerous national brands such as Champ's Sports and a thriving arts district, Bradenton apartments for rent are available to suit a wide range of lifestyles and budgets. Brimming with Florida charm as well as much in the way of natural beauty thanks to lublic parks and rivers, this jewel of the sunshine state is a must-consider for anyone eager to connect with a new place to call home in the south.

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Bradenton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Bradenton?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Bradenton is at Luxe Lakewood Ranch listed at $1,415.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Bradenton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Bradenton is $2,292.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Bradenton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Bradenton is a 2,424 square feet unit starting from $2,099 at Stellar at Masters Avenue.

What is the average size for Bradenton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Bradenton is currently at 856 sq ft.
